United States Imports from Canada of Potatoes (except sweet potatoes), fresh or chilled was US$389.35 Million during 2024, according to the United Nations COMTRADE database on international trade. This is an interactive potato variety database that allows researchers and end-users to access and obtain potato variety trial results in one centralized site. It was developed primarily for scientists interested in potato variety development, growers, and allied industry members. The database is populated with the results of potato variety trials conducted in eight states (Florida, Maine, New Jersey, New York, North Carolina, Ohio, Pennsylvania, and Virginia) and two Canadian provinces (Prince Edward Island and Quebec). New potato varieties are needed in the East to serve a wide range of markets including fresh market, chipping, French fry processing, and seed industries. However, developing new high quality, pest resistant potato varieties adapted to broad geographic regions or specifically suited for new niche markets is no small task. In today's economic climate these efforts increasingly require a multi-disciplinary, regionalized approach to meet tomorrow's demands.
The Eastern Potato Variety Development team is composed of breeders, molecular biologists, cultural management specialists, plant pathologists, entomologists and extension specialists from over 8 states and 2 Canadian provinces. The overall goal is to develop an array of attractive, high yielding, disease- and insect- resistant, table-stock, processing and/or specialty-type potato varieties that can be employed by potato producers in the eastern United States.
The database currently contains over 35 data features and was developed primarily for scientists interested in potato variety development, growers, and allied industry members. Data points that can be selected include: Released varieties, Tuber Color, End Use. Vine Maturity, Specific Gravity, Appearance Score, Year Evaluated, many Primary Harvest Data categories (yield by hundredweight, shape, texture, color), Defects categories, Plant Maturity, Number of Replications, Days to Harvest, Total Rainfall, Parents, Degree Days, and Expected Use. According to Cognitive Market Research, the global fresh potatoes market size will be USD 95288.5 million in 2024. It will expand at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 4.00% from 2024 to 2031.
North America held the major market share for more than 40% of the global revenue with a market size of USD 38115.40 million in 2024 and will grow at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 2.2% from 2024 to 2031.
Europe accounted for a market share of over 30% of the global revenue with a market size of USD 28586.55 million.
Asia Pacific held a market share of around 23% of the global revenue with a market size of USD 21916.36 million in 2024 and will grow at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 6.0% from 2024 to 2031.
Latin America had a market share of more than 5% of the global revenue with a market size of USD 4764.43 million in 2024 and will grow at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 3.4% from 2024 to 2031.
Middle East and Africa had a market share of around 2% of the global revenue and was estimated at a market size of USD 1905.77 million in 2024 and will grow at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 3.7% from 2024 to 2031.

Restraint Factor for the Fresh Potatoes Market
Intricate production procedure, will Limit Market Growth
The fresh potato industry is hampered in part by the logistics chain's susceptibility to difficulties, which can have a major effect on the cost and availability of potatoes throughout the world. Because potatoes are consumable, they must be harvested, stored, and transported with effective logistics to guarantee that they get to customers in the best possible situation. Nevertheless, a number of obstacles, such as adverse climates, insects and illnesses, and transportation issues, can affect the fresh potato transportation process and result in lower supply and higher prices.
